Company Description Bina Darulaman Berhad (BDB) is an investment holding company with subsidiaries recognized across Kedah for infrastructure engineering, construction, property development, and tourism. Since its establishment more than two decades ago, BDB has contributed significantly to the state’s socioeconomic development through successful project implementation. Incorporated on 7 February 1995 and listed on the Main Board of Bursa Malaysia on 2 February 1996, the group has grown into a workforce with strong expertise and specialized skills. In 2015, BDB introduced a new corporate identity and the tagline “Spirit of Achievement,” reflecting its forward-looking goals and collaborative culture focused on achieving corporate objectives.
